Rubio, other officials defend Russia outreach as Ukraine says it will 'never accept' imposed peace

Top Trump administration officials on Sunday defended their upcoming direct talks with Moscow over ending the Russia-Ukraine war, even as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y vowed that he will “never accept” a deal negotiated without Kyiv present at the table.
